About CarCo Truck
CarCo Truck and Equipment is a Heavy Truck dealership located in Rice, MN. We offer equipment like ambulances, fire trucks, crane trucks, logging trailers and more from brands like Swaploader, Whelen, Husky, and Akron. We also offer parts, heavy and medium duty towing, and full vehicle service. We serve the areas of Royalton, St Stephen, Watab and Little Rock.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Minneap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Minneap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at CarCo Truck.
Minneap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 7.9% more than MN average). Major city, vibrant, housing costs above US avg, cold winters (high heating). Metro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from CarCo Truck,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of CarCo Truck sal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$230 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$120 (Metro Transit mon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,920 - $4,480+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
